About 12 sinkholes have opened in Sea Bright beach, located in New Jersey, during the past days.
The sinkholes that are up to 1 meter wide and deep, appeared on the beach after Subtropical Storm Melissa struck the area on October 9, 2019. “Someone could fall in, never come out,” Kyle Hopfensperger, a business owner, stated.
According to officials, the sinkholes were triggered due to a combination of heavy rainfall and the construction of a sea wall. In particular, sand moves through rock blocks as they settle to create the wall and rain exacerbated the phenomenon. “We believe the sinkholes were caused due to the construction of the sea wall project. The settling of the rocks around there, the sand is supposed to kind of find its way between those and with heavy rains that we experienced last week, that’s kind of the issue we’re dealing with,” Dan Chernavsky, Sea Bright Office of Emergency Management coordinator, clarified.
Authorities have warned people to stay out of the beach until further notice. A major issue is that the ground near the sinkholes is also unstable and may cave in if someone walks over it.
Danny Ciambrone, a local, fell on a 60-centimeter sinkhole while walking on the beach. He mentioned that authorities have established some alert signs but not all people are careful. “I just saw the sand had giant holes and there wasn’t just one; there were 10. A lot of people walk their dogs up and down. You see the caution signs, but you don’t really know that it’s a real thing," he said.
The tropical storm also caused steep slopes to appear on some of Jersey's beaches. The most affected areas are located in the Atlantic and Cape May counties. According to Steve Hafner, assistant director at Stockton University’s Coastal Research Center, those inclines will be addressed using a bulldozer or by depositing sand to level the ground.
Mr. Chernavsky stated that sinkholes will keep emerging as sand moves through the aforementioned rock blocks.
